Quick answers for Texas CRE agents.
- Do I really keep 100% of my commission?
- Yes. There are no splits or percentage cuts. Spirit charges a flat $99/month plus a $300–$500 contract review fee per closed deal — the rest of the commission is yours.
- How is the $300–$500 review fee decided?
- It's quoted up front based on the size and complexity of the contract — a small lease typically lands near $300, while a multi-tenant purchase or complex LOI sits closer to $500. You'll know the fee before you send the deal in.
- Who actually reviews the contract?
- Spirit's in-house counsel reviews every commercial purchase contract, letter of intent, and lease, with broker oversight from Bryan. They check contract language, TREC compliance, and protect your commission so the deal closes cleanly.
- How and when do I get paid?
- Spirit invoices the client or title company and disburses commission to you via direct deposit on the 1st and 15th of the month — a 99.9% collection rate means you actually get paid.
- Can I run my business through an LLC?
- Yes. Spirit allows licensed commercial agents to receive commissions through a registered Texas LLC or corporation. See the LLC / Corp Brokerage plan if the entity itself needs to be the licensed Business Entity Broker.
- Are there production minimums?
- No. Close one commercial deal a year or twenty — the $99/month sponsorship is the same. Park your license with Spirit while you build your pipeline.
